The HTMLMediaElement.ended
indicates whether the media element has ended playback.
Syntax
var isEnded = HTMLMediaElement.ended
Value
A Boolean
which is true
if the media contained in the element has finished playing.
If the source of the media is a MediaStream
, this value is true
if the value of the stream's active
property is false
.
Example
var obj = document.createElement('video');
console.log(obj.ended); // false
